Zoya intently waited for his answer though she was shivering with fear. What could it be? She tried to look at his face but her eyes were masked with her tears, making everything a blur.

"Because you are unworthy of me." He whispered, moving his mouth away. Zoya however froze at his cruel words. Was he that egoistic? Was he that blind? It was Zoya he didn't deserve but she still ran after him, hoping to find a soft-hearted man beneath all the facade. But she was wrong. There was nothing in his to discover or uncover. He was what he showed himself to be. He was a bloody narcissist who can't think of anyone but himself. One by one the tear drops raced down Zoya's face. She didn't know what to say.

"You-you are unworthy of me, my family, my house, my life, my everything!" he screamed, holding her wrists tighter. His voice cracked and there were tears in his eyes but Zoya knew they were there because of his anger and not because he was hurting her.

A small sob escaped Zoya's lips. She felt as if she was being held up by her hands that were pinned to her door because her lower body had already given up. She wanted to crumble down, fall to her knees and bawl. But she didn't want to look weak in front of him. Biting her lips hard, she tried to gain some control by shifting and trying to push Asad away. When all failed she faced him and said, "Leave me Mr. Khan."

Asad's arms dropped immediately. Not because Zoya asked him to do so, but because of her eyes. They looked so hurt and dark. It was as if she was talking to a stranger. He looked at them expectantly, trying to find a flicker of recognition. The glisten in her eyes whenever she looked at him. But he found nothing. There was nothing in them. He felt so lost.

Zoya gathered up the last ounce of strength in her and opened her mouth, "You really think that don't you Mr. Khan?" She stepped aside and opened the door. She carefully backed out of his room but did not leave his eyes.

"I do Ms. Farooqui." It seemed like this was becoming a stare competition. Neither was willing to give up or look away.

"Guess what Mr. Khan, I know you're lying." Asad hurt by her cold, raw voice looked away and wondered how could he ever convince her otherwise.

Zoya wondered how could she ever give this man another chance. Why was she always expecting his hate to be a lie. Maybe he did hate her. Then why did she just say that on impulse? Why did he look away?

When Asad turned to face her, he had composed himself. "Ms. Farooqui, the truth is so bitter that you better be satisfied with this lie. Sach janengi to hiss ghaar me kabhi nahi reh payengi."

"I want to know the truth Mr. Khan, at least the fact that you don't hate me will be cleared."

Asad stepped back and sneered, "Oh you are mistaken Ms. Farooqui, it makes me hate you much more!" He gritted his teeth as he recalled his conversation with Tanveer.

"You think you are so brave right Ms. Farooqui. So optimistic. Trying to bring laughter and light into other people's lives when your own is drowned in darkness and betrayal. The truth will do nothing but make it worse, trust me on that." Seeing no reaction from Zoya, Asad reached for the door knob and slammed the door.

"OWCH!" came a loud yelp from outside. Asad's heart jumped into his throat as he rushed to open the door. Had he-? The answer was in front of his eyes. Zoya was holding the side of her palm in her mouth and her face was filled with tears, old stains and new trails. Asad reached for her hands but Zoya pulled them away from him.

"Don't Mr. Khan." She said in a deep serious voice even though she was crying.

"Ms. Farooqui, don't act like a child, show it to me. It can be bad." Asad said desperately, he needed to see what he had done. He needed to heal it by his soft kisses. No matter how much he tried he always ended up hurting her.

"Please-" he croaked, his eyes filling up.

Zoya chuckled sarcastically. "It's not worse than your words Mr. Khan, don't worry. This wound will heal in a couple of days but your words they scar me forever. Stay away from me Mr. Khan I will leave this house as soon as possible. I'll tell Am-Phuphi that I don't want to get married to you. You can get married to Tanveer. But yes, you will have to tell me the truth."

Asad watched as she struggled to get up. He swallowed when he saw how bad her wound was. The skin had peeled of and it was bleeding a bit too. The area around it had turned bluish-black. Asad shut his eyes. When would this all stop? He couldn't bear it. He stood there silently as Zoya walked down the stairs, not once looking back.

Zoya slammed the door and sat by her window. If Dilshad hadn't gone to her community service office and Najma to college then she would have never done that. Only Mr. Khan was in the house and he deserved to hear that.

She flipped her palm and stared at the wound. Surprisingly it wasn't hurting much, probably because the stinging in her heart was overpowering it. She knew it was an accident but she hated him nonetheless. This was the last thing she needed from him.

"I hate him!" she said, blowing on the wound and pulling out a first aid kit box from her drawer.

Just as she was going to apply the ointment, Asad barged in through her door. His hair was disheveled and his eyes bloodshot.

"I need to tell you something."

Zoya concentrated on her dressing and then replied, "Is there anything left to tell?" She did not bother facing him.

"Yes there is. The truth." Asad said, emphasizing his point.

"Oh really the truth. Mr. Khan aap ko yaad nahi hoga. You already told me the truth. You hate me. I hate you. There's nothing more."

"No Zoya, you don't remember, I told you there is something worse than that." He walked to Zoya and kneeled beside her.

"Here me out, please."

"No!" yelled Zoya. She stood up and backed away. "No, I don't want to hear anything." She placed her hands on her ears and screamed, "I don't care Mr. Khan. I don't want to hurt anymore! You hate me! That's it!"

She did not understand why she was acting so paranoid, but Zoya knew that what Asad was going to throw at her was going to break her more. She didn't want to know.

Asad got up clumsily and walked towards her. He was about to open his mouth but Zoya shoved him away which made Asad fall back on his back on her bed.

Asad groaned and tried to get up.

"Ms. Farooqui, it's about your Abbu."

Zoya's ears perked up immediately. Her Abbu? Asad knew about her Abbu. Yah Allah, aap ka bohut bohut shukria. Zoya ran and sat by Asad. She grabbed his arm and asked, "You found out about my Abbu? You know where he is?" Zoya could not contain her joy. All her life she had waited for this moment. She wound her arms around him and pulled him into a tight hug, leaving her tears of joy to do the talk.

Asad's body trembled as he nodded. "I found out a couple of days ago."

The sparkling smile slowly faded as Zoya grasped onto what Asad had just said. She removed her head from his shoulders and looked up. Those cursed tears were back on her face. Zoya who was shaking with anger, grabbed Asad's collar and demanded, "You knew about my father and you didn't tell me? What were you thinking Mr. Khan? How could you do this to me-?" Zoya let her head fall as she cried her heart out. Her hands were still gripping Asad's collar but neither cared.

After a few sobs and hiccups, Zoya left Asad's collar and spoke up. "Who is he Mr. Khan?"

Zoya was still half sprawled in Asad's lap but she made no attempt to move. She didn't want to.

Asad reached for her hand and laced their fingers together, smiling a little when he saw her ring. But he knew he had to tell her everything even though it would take her away from him. She deserved to know and Asad had been wrong in hiding it from her.

"Ms. Farooqui your Abbu is an enemy. No matter what you do or what you say, I cannot accept you. I don't know how to tell you this but once everyone knows the truth you can't stay-"

"Wait."

"Huh?" Asad looked at her.

"Please don't tell me that I'm Rashid Ahmed Khan's daughter." Zoya whispered with her eyes shut. Her insides squelched with disgust. Asad was her bhaijaan. Yah Allah, how can you do this?

Allah's reply was a whole hearted laugh. Zoya opened her eyes and saw Asad laughing uncontrollably. The corners of his eyes were tearing up and Zoya couldn't have been more confused.

"No-no-hahaha-n-no, you're-hahah-not Rashid-K-Khan's daughter!" Asad exclaimed between his laughs.

Zoya's pounding heart calmed down but it took on the same pace when Asad said, "But he's related to him."

"What do you mean?"

"You are Ghaffur's daughter, Zoya." He had finally said it. It felt like he had removed the heaviest burden from his heart. But why was Zoya still here? Wasn't she supposed to leave as soon as the truth was out? Wasn't he imagining himself screaming and them fighting? Then why was everything so placid. Why was she still in his arms?

"Ghaffur?" Zoya repeated. The name sounded familiar but Zoya couldn't put a face to it.

"Humeira's Abbu." Asad mumbled and removed his hand from hers. Zoya's face went pale when she realized that she had met her father numerous times. She had even talked to him! Fate, how can you play such games? She had looked for her father everywhere but turns out he had been there in front of her eyes since so long.

"I-I have so many questions. I-I don't k-know what to say. I have to go." Zoya mumbled as she scooted away from Asad. She had to meet her Abbu. She had to get all her answers.

Zoya got up and rushed out the door leaving a broken Asad behind. Asad held his tears because he knew that their story ended right here. They would never be this close again.

"Shukria Allah, Zoya ko meri zindaagi me laane ke liye. Mujhe pata tha ki woh kuch hi dino ki mehmaan hain. Kyunki aap ko mujhse kushiyaan cheen lene ki aadat joh hai. Shaiyad me ishi layak hoon."
